Types of Broken Car Keys
There are numerous types of car keys, and the method of replacement might differ based upon the key type.
Kind Of Car KeyDescriptionConventional Metal KeyBasic metal keys, generally not programmable.Transponder KeyIncludes an embedded chip that communicates with the vehicle's ignition system.Smart KeyKeyless entry keys that use distance sensing units for beginning the engine and accessing the vehicle.Key FobA remote control type mobile key replacement utilized for locking/unlocking doors and in some cases beginning the vehicle.Steps to Replace a Broken Car Key
Changing a broken car key can be simple if you understand the ideal steps to follow. Below are the basic procedures for replacing different key types.
Step 1: Assess the DamageRecognize the Type of Key: Determine whether it is a traditional key, transponder key, smart key, or key fob.Analyze the Condition: Is it snappable, or is it partly functional? Comprehending the extent of the damage is essential for the next actions.Step 2: Locate a Spare or Duplicate
If you have a spare key, you can use it to create a new key. For instance:
Duplicate Key: Visit a locksmith professional or hardware shop that can develop a duplicate based upon your spare.Transponder Key or Key Fob: These might need unique equipment for copying.Action 3: Contact a Locksmith or DealerPick a Professional: If you do not have a spare, getting in touch with a regional locksmith or your car's car dealership is suggested.Supply Vehicle Information: Be prepared to provide your vehicle's make, design, and year, along with proof of ownership.Step 4: Program the New Key (if essential)
For keys with electronic parts, extra programs might be required to guarantee they deal with your vehicle's systems. This action is particularly essential for transponder keys and wise keys.
Step 5: Test the New Key
When the new key is created or configured, it's vital to evaluate it in all performances to guarantee dependability. Locking/unlocking doors and beginning the engine needs to work efficiently.
